How to rectify errors in your tax return

Checking and fixing mistakes in your tax return is important if you want to get the most out of your refund. Start with your tax documents. Look for anything that does not match, like a social security number or an adjusted gross income that isn’t right. If you find a mistake, you will need to file an amended federal tax return with Form 1040X. You can use this form to fix things about your credits. These may be things like the earned income tax credit or child tax credit. Always double-check your bank account information. If it is wrong, it can slow down your refund.

Potential deductions to consider for 2025

There are a few important deductions that can help grow your tax refund for the 2025 filing year. Medical costs that are more than 7.5% of your adjusted gross income may count. Be sure to check if you can get the Earned Income Tax Credit (EITC). This income tax credit can make your tax refund much bigger. You should also think about any money you put into retirement accounts. This could drop your taxable income. Finally, remember child tax credit payments for your dependents.
